Any chance that the system could be duplicated (like it is programmed multiple times) in your scanner? You might be avoiding the channel for the first iteration, but when the scanner listens to the duplicated version, that channel hasn't been avoided.

This can happen when someone does a write to scanner without checking the Erase Favorites in Scanner box.
